An earthquake measuring 4.8 magnitude on the Richter scale struck the Solomon Islands in the Pacific Ocean on Wednesday.The epicenter of the quake was 124 km from Lata area in the Islands, at a depth of 10 km, the US Geological Survey reported.So far, there have been no reports of casualties or material damage as a result of the tremor.The Solomon Islands are located in an area of strong seismic activity and strong earthquakes.Source: Qatar News Agency
